Key Types of Painkillers Available in Spain
Before delving into the specific suppliers, it is vital to classify the types of painkillers available in the market:
| Type of Painkiller | Description |
|---|---|
| Non-Opioid Analgesics | Consists of non-prescription medications such as acetaminophen and NSAIDs like ibuprofen. |
| Opioid Analgesics | Prescription medications like morphine, oxycodone, and fentanyl utilized for serious pain. |
| Adjuvant Analgesics | Medications not mainly designed for pain relief, such as antidepressants and Sitio web de analgésicos en España anticonvulsants, utilized in specific persistent pain conditions. |
| Topical Analgesics | Creams and spots consisting of active components that offer localized pain relief. |

The Role of Regulation in Pain Management
The Spanish Agency of Medicines and Medical Devices (AEMPS) plays an important function in controling painkiller vendors. The agency's main focus is guaranteeing the safety and efficacy of medications readily available in Spain. Secret regulatory initiatives include:
- Prescription Monitoring Programs: AEMPS has actually instituted programs to track opioid prescriptions to avoid abuse.
- Drug Approval Processes: Vendors should adhere to strict screening and scientific trial requirements before their products can be marketed.
- Public Awareness Campaigns: The federal government carries out campaigns to inform clients on the correct usage of painkillers and the dangers associated with misuse.
F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TION
1. What are the most frequently used over the counter painkillers in Spain?
The most common non-prescription painkillers in Spain consist of ibuprofen, paracetamol (acetaminophen), and aspirin, which are commonly used for moderate to moderate pain relief.
2. Are opioids readily offered in Spain?
Opioids are readily available in Spain however are strictly regulated. Patients typically require a prescription from a certified doctor to get these medications.
3. How can patients handle chronic pain?
Clients can handle chronic pain through a combination of medication, physical therapy, lifestyle modifications, and holistic approaches such as acupuncture. It's important to speak with a health care professional for a personalized pain management strategy.
4. What factors should be thought about when picking a painkiller?
When picking a painkiller, factors such as the kind of pain, duration of signs, possible adverse effects, individual health conditions, and previous medication responses need to be thought about.
5. Exist any threats related to painkiller use?
Yes, dangers can consist of side impacts ranging from intestinal issues with NSAIDs to the potential for addiction with opioids. Proper assistance from health care suppliers is important in reducing these dangers.
